Ian Hunter
Ian Hunter, the legendary Mott The Hoople front man and
renowned solo artist, has signed to New West Records. Man Overboard,
released on July 21st 2009, is Mr. Hunter's anticipated follow up to
his critically acclaimed 2007 solo album Shrunken Heads (his first release
after a six-year gap).
With Mott The Hoople, Ian Hunter quickly established himself as an
incredibly inventive songwriter with his gritty and thought provoking
songs which paved the way for the original wave of punk rock. The 1972
David Bowie-produced breakthrough album All The Young Dudes catapulted
the band into the British Top 10 and the American Top 40. Additionally,
the band was the first act to ever sell out a week of Broadway concerts
in New York City. Ian Hunter's autobiography, Diary Of A Rock and Roll
Star, written during the band's 1972 US Tour and published in 1974,
was also acclaimed by Q Magazine as "the greatest music book ever
written".
